Output d51a0feaae805baddc3eb2ae7ae8bb40c89fef1988f2506bc3ddede458e33025:0
- value
- 22943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dba86e2ccf94bfbd2c59238102c832e4ee051dcd OP_EQUAL
- address
- 3MiTgJU6MykhnoxmZBRyJsBkuMdg6qPhJj
- transaction
- d51a0feaae805baddc3eb2ae7ae8bb40c89fef1988f2506bc3ddede458e33025